Professional license lookups are split by job

California has separate lookup paths for many licensed workers, including DCA boards, real estate licensees, and insurance licensees.

California does not keep every professional license in one neat box. A contractor, nurse, barber, real estate agent, insurance agent, and many other workers can be checked, but the right search depends on the job.

DCA’s license search covers many boards and bureaus. Real estate licensees have a separate Department of Real Estate lookup. Insurance licensees have a Department of Insurance tool. Use the name, license number, business name, and city when you have them.

Check the license before money changes hands. Look for the name match, license status, business address, and any limits shown on the record. If the lookup does not match the person in front of you, slow down and ask for the exact license information.
